实现Redis的参考文献
概述
在开始教会新人如何实现Redis的参考文献之前,我们先来了解一下整个过程的流程。下面是一张表格,展示了实现Redis的参考文献的步骤:
步骤 | 描述 |
---|---|
步骤1 | 连接到Redis服务器 |
步骤2 | 添加参考文献到Redis |
步骤3 | 获取参考文献信息 |
步骤4 | 更新参考文献信息 |
步骤5 | 删除参考文献 |
现在,让我们一步步来完成这个任务。
步骤1:连接到Redis服务器
首先,我们需要连接到Redis服务器。下面是使用Python连接到Redis服务器的代码:
import redis
# 创建Redis连接
r = redis.Redis(host='localhost', port=6379, db=0)
这段代码使用了redis模块中的Redis类来创建与Redis服务器的连接。在这里,我们需要指定Redis服务器的主机和端口号,可以根据实际情况进行修改。
步骤2:添加参考文献到Redis
接下来,我们需要将参考文献添加到Redis中。下面是添加参考文献的代码:
# 添加参考文献
def add_reference(reference_id, reference_info):
r.set(reference_id, reference_info)
这段代码定义了一个add_reference函数,接受两个参数:reference_id表示参考文献的唯一标识符,reference_info表示参考文献的具体信息。使用r.set方法将参考文献信息存储到Redis中。
步骤3:获取参考文献信息
要获取参考文献的信息,我们可以使用Redis的get方法。下面是获取参考文献信息的代码:
# 获取参考文献
def get_reference(reference_id):
reference_info = r.get(reference_id)
return reference_info
这段代码定义了一个get_reference函数,接受一个参数reference_id。使用r.get方法从Redis中获取指定参考文献的信息,并将其返回。
步骤4:更新参考文献信息
有时候我们需要更新参考文献的信息。下面是更新参考文献信息的代码:
# 更新参考文献
def update_reference(reference_id, new_reference_info):
r.set(reference_id, new_reference_info)
这段代码定义了一个update_reference函数,接受两个参数:reference_id表示需要更新的参考文献的唯一标识符,new_reference_info表示新的参考文献信息。使用r.set方法将新的参考文献信息更新到Redis中。
步骤5:删除参考文献
如果我们需要删除某个参考文献,可以使用Redis的delete方法。下面是删除参考文献的代码:
# 删除参考文献
def delete_reference(reference_id):
r.delete(reference_id)
这段代码定义了一个delete_reference函数,接受一个参数reference_id表示需要删除的参考文献的唯一标识符。使用r.delete方法从Redis中删除指定的参考文献。
总结
通过以上步骤,我们可以实现对Redis的参考文献的添加、获取、更新和删除操作。你可以根据实际需求,在这个基础上进行扩展和优化。
希望这篇文章对你有帮助,如果还有其他问题,请随时提问。